A student believes that no more than 20% (i.e. , 20%)of the students who finish a statistics course get an A.A random sample of 100 students was taken.Twenty-four percent of the students in the sample received A's.
a.State the null and alternative hypotheses.
b.Using the critical value approach,test the hypotheses at the 1% level of significance.
c.Using the p-value approach,test the hypotheses at the 1% level of significance.
